Compartilhar via


Export-ActiveSyncLog

 

Aplica-se a: Exchange Server 2007 SP3, Exchange Server 2007 SP2, Exchange Server 2007 SP1

Tópico modificado em: 2007-08-22

O cmdlet Export-ActiveSyncLog analisa os logs do IIS (Serviços de Informações da Internet) e retorna informações sobre o uso do Microsoft Exchange ActiveSync, na tela ou em um arquivo de saída.

Sintaxe

Export-ActiveSyncLog -Filename <FileInfo> [-Confirm [<SwitchParameter>]] [-EndDate <DateTime>] [-Force <SwitchParameter>] [-OutputPath <DirectoryInfo>] [-OutputPrefix <String>] [-StartDate <DateTime>] [-UseGMT <SwitchParameter>] [-WhatIf [<SwitchParameter>]]

Descrição detalhada

O cmdlet Export-ActiveSyncLog analisa os arquivos de log do IIS e retorna informações sobre o uso do Exchange ActiveSync. Esse cmdlet pode exportar a saída para um arquivo ou exibi-la no Shell de Gerenciamento do Exchange.

Para executar o cmdlet Export-ActiveSyncLog, você deve usar uma conta que tenha a função Administrador de Destinatários do Exchange.

Para obter mais informações sobre permissões, delegação de funções e os direitos necessários para administrar o Microsoft Exchange Server 2007, consulte Considerações sobre permissão

Parâmetros

Parâmetro Necessário Tipo Descrição

Filename

Necessário

System.IO.FileInfo

Esse parâmetro especifica o caminho UNC (Convenção de Nomenclatura Universal) dos logs do IIS.

EndDate

Opcional

System.DateTime

Esse parâmetro especifica a data de término do intervalo de data do relatório.

OutputPath

Opcional

System.IO.DirectoryInfo

Esse parâmetro especifica o nome e o local do arquivo de saída.

OutputPrefix

Opcional

System.String

Esse parâmetro especifica um prefixo para anexar ao nome do arquivo de saída.

StartDate

Opcional

System.DateTime

Esse parâmetro especifica a data de início do intervalo de data do relatório.

UseGMT

Opcional

System.Management.Automation.SwitchParameter

Esse parâmetro especifica o Tempo Universal Coordenado (Hora de Greenwich) que será usado como hora na saída do relatório. Por padrão, se esse parâmetro não for especificado, a hora local será usada.

Confirm

Optional

System.Management.Automation.SwitchParameter

Esse parâmetro faz com que o comando pause o processamento e exige que você confirme o que o comando fará antes que o processamento continue. Você não precisa especificar um valor com o parâmetro Confirm.

Force

Optional

System.Management.Automation.SwitchParameter

Esse parâmetro suprime as mensagens de aviso ou de confirmação exibidas durante alterações específicas na configuração.

WhatIf

Optional

System.Management.Automation.SwitchParameter

Este parâmetro instrui o comando a simular as ações que ele executaria no objeto. Ao usar este parâmetro, você poderá exibir quais alterações ocorrerão sem precisar aplicar nenhuma dessas alterações. Você não precisa especificar valor algum com este parâmetro.

Tipos de entrada

Tipos de retorno

Erros

Erro Descrição

Exceções

Exceções Descrição

Exemplo

O exemplo de código a seguir exporta o log do Exchange ActiveSync para o intervalo de data 08/06/06 a 09/06/06. As horas no relatório estarão em UTC (Tempo Universal Coordenado) e o relatório será salvo em c:\Computer\Reports.

Export-ActiveSyncLog -FileName: "c:\Windows\System32\LogFiles\W2SVC1\ex060614.log" -StartDate:"06/08/06" -EndDate:"06/09/06" -UseGMT:$true -OutputPath:"c:\computer\reports"